Roasted Spicy Brussels Sprouts

Total time: 45 min • Prep: 20 min • Cook: 25 min • Serves: 4 • Difficulty: Easy

Roasting Brussels sprouts tames their slight bitterness. They pair so well with a hint of salt - soy sauce and ham - and a touch of heat – ginger and hot sauce.

Ingredients

Brussels sprouts

1 pound(s), (450 g) medium-size

Olive oil

1 tbsp(s), (15 ml)

Ground ginger

1 tsp(s), (5 ml)

Low sodium soy sauce

1 tbsp(s), (15 ml)

Table salt

¼ tsp(s), (1 ml)

Black pepper

¼ pinch(es), (1 ml) freshly ground

Uncooked Canadian bacon

1 slice(s), (28 g) diced

Sriracha hot sauce

1 tbsp(s), (15 ml)

Instructions

1

Preheat oven 200°C (400°F). Line a roasting pan with aluminum foil or coat pan with cooking spray.

2

Remove any yellow outer leaves from Brussels sprouts; trim ends and slice each one in half.

3

Place Brussels sprouts, oil, ginger, soy sauce, salt and pepper on prepared pan; toss to combine and roast 15 minutes.

4

Remove pan from oven and add ham and sriracha; toss to coat. Roast until Brussels sprouts are just tender when pierced with a knife and bacon is just crispy, about 10 minutes.

5

Serving size: 175 ml (3/4 cup)
